Project Overview – NGO Health Jobs in Pakistan 2025
The Flood Emergency Response Project aims to deliver essential healthcare services to displaced and flood-affected populations in Sindh. The project operates through a network of mobile medical units and static healthcare centers, providing:
Curative and preventive care
Maternal, newborn, and child health services (MNCH)
Routine immunizations and outbreak response
Coordination with government health departments and humanitarian partners
Medical Officers will play a central role in ensuring quality care and effective service delivery in underserved areas.
Job Description – Medical Officer Positions in Sindh 2025
As a Medical Officer, your core responsibilities will include:
Delivering primary healthcare and emergency treatment through mobile and static units
Diagnosing and managing communicable and non-communicable diseases
Supporting maternal and child health services (antenatal, postnatal, referrals)
Working closely with nurses, LHVs, paramedics, and community health workers
Collaborating with EPI offices and local health authorities for immunization coverage
Leading response to health outbreaks and emergency situations
Ensuring use of HMIS/DHIS systems for data collection and reporting
Adhering to clinical protocols, IPC (Infection Prevention and Control) standards, and medical ethics
Training and mentoring support staff in clinical best practices
Compiling daily, weekly, and monthly medical reports
Ensuring compliance with safeguarding, protection, and humanitarian principles
This is a frontline role where your clinical skills will directly impact the health outcomes of at-risk communities.
